ホームページ バックエンド開発 PHPチュートリアル PHP 5.3の環境構築方法(apache2.2 mysql5.1)_PHPチュートリアル

PHP 5.3の環境構築方法(apache2.2 mysql5.1)_PHPチュートリアル

Jul 13, 2016 am 10:53 AM
php 利用 方法 はい 環境 構成

この PHP 5.3 環境の構築方法は、Apache2.2.16+PHP5.3.3+MySQL5.1.49 の構成を使用します。インストールと設定のチュートリアルを見てみましょう。

このphpチュートリアルの5.3環境設定方法は、apache2.2.16+php5.3.3+mysqlチュートリアル5.1.49の設定を使用します。インストールと設定チュートリアルを見てみましょう。

ステップ 1: インストールファイルをダウンロードします
1. mysql: ダウンロードアドレス mysql-5.1.49-win32.msi; 2. apache: ダウンロードアドレス httpd-2.2.16-win32-x86-openssl-0.9.8o.msi; 3. php5.3.3 ダウンロード アドレス php-5.3.3-win32-vc6-x86 注: 必ず php-5.3.3-win32-vc6-x86 バージョンをダウンロードしてください
はい、php-5.3.3-nts-win32-vc6-x86 バージョンは、iis サーバーのインストール バージョンであるため、vc9 バージョンはもちろんのこと、ダウンロードしないでください。
ステップ 2: ファイルをインストールする
1. インストールするディスク上にフォルダーを作成します (著者のアプローチは、d ドライブのルート ディレクトリに php フォルダー d:php を作成することです)。
2. Apache サーバーをインストールします。インストール完了後のディレクトリは d:phpapache になります。
3. ダウンロードした php-5.3.3-win32-vc6-x86 を解凍した d:php ディレクトリで、フォルダーの名前を短く変更できます。結果は d:phpphp5 になります。 4. mysql データベース チュートリアルをインストールします。インストールは通常と同じです。著者はこれを (d:phpmysql) と php と同じディレクトリにインストールしました。
ステップ 3: php5.3.3 を構成する
1. php5.3.3 を設定し、php インストール ディレクトリを開きます (作成者は d:phpphp5)。ディレクトリ内に php.ini-development と php.ini-production という 2 つのファイルがあることがわかります。開発に使用される構成ファイル、2 番目は標準の実稼働環境構成です。
2. php.ini-development を選択して同じディレクトリにコピーし、名前を php.ini に変更します。テキスト ツールで開き、extension_dir を検索します。 2 つを参照し、Windows で以下の 1 つを選択し、先頭のセミコロンを extension_dir = "d:/php/php5/ext" (リーダーのルート) に変更します
独自のディレクトリ構造構成に従って、php.ini と同じディレクトリの ext フォルダーで拡張ライブラリを見つけることが目的です。
3. extension=php_ を見つけて、extension=php_curl.dll、extension=php_gd2.dll、extension=php_mbstring.dll、
を削除します。 extension=php_mysql.dll、extension=php_mysqli.dll、extension=php_pdo_mysql.dll、extension=php_xmlrpc.dll フロント
セミコロン。 short_open_tag = off を見つけて、それを short_open_tag = on に変更して、短いタグをサポートします。
4. php5ts.dll ファイルを windows/system32 ディレクトリにコピーします。php5ts.dll は php-5.3.3-win32-vc6-x86 バージョンでのみ使用できます
php-5.3.3-nts-win32-vc6-x86 バージョンはありません。
ステップ 4: Apache を構成する
1. Apache ディレクトリの下の conf ディレクトリにある httpd.conf ファイルを開き、最後の 128 行目あたりにある #loadmodule を探します
追加:
ロードモジュール php5_module "d:/php/php5/php5apache2_2.dll"
phpinidir "d:/php/php5"
addtype application/x-httpd-php .php
addtype application/x-httpd-php .htm
addtype application/x-httpd-php .html
ディレクトリ構造はユーザー自身のディレクトリに従って構成されます。
2. directoryindexindex.htmlを見つけて、それをdirectoryindexindex.phpdefault.phpindex.htmlindex.htmdefault.htmlに変更します
デフォルト.htm
3. documentroot を見つけて、Web ファイルを配置する必要があるフォルダーを指すように変更します (作成者は d:/php ディレクトリにファイルを作成しました
) www フォルダー)なので、documentroot は documentroot "d:/php/www" となり、読者は独自の設定に従ってこれを変更できます。
4. <ディレクトリを見つけて、独自に設定したドキュメントルートのパスに変更します (作成者は <ディレクトリ "d:/php/www"> です)
ステップ 5: php+apache+mysql が正常に構成されているかどうかをテストします
1. mysql を開き、mysql 内に新しいデータベースとテーブルを作成します。 (作成者の userinfo データベースと users テーブルには、id と name の 2 つのフィールドがあります)
テスト?シンプルにしてください、笑! !
2. 上記で作成した www フォルダーにindex.php ファイルを作成し、editplus またはその他のテキスト ツールで開きます。
3. 書きます:


コードをコピーします コードは次のとおりです:

$db_host = "ローカルホスト"; $db_user = "ルート"; $db_pass = "ルート"; $db_name = "ユーザー情報";

mysql_connect($db_host,$db_user,$db_pass); mysql_select_db($db_name);


mysql_query("セット名 gb2312"); $sql = "ユーザーから * を選択"; $result = mysql_query($sql); while($data=mysql_fetch_array($result)){
エコー「----------------------」
echo $data['id']."
"; echo $data['name']."
"; }
mysql_close(); ?>


4. Apache サーバーを起動し、ブラウザに http://www.bKjia.c0m と入力して Enter を押します。

下の写真が表示されたら、完了したことを意味します。おめでとう!


www.bkjia.comtru​​ehttp://www.bkjia.com/PHPjc/632364.html技術記事この PHP 5.3 環境の構築方法は、Apache2.2.16+PHP5.3.3+MySQL5.1.49 の構成を使用するものです。インストールと設定のチュートリアルを見てみましょう。 このPHPチュートリアル5.3の環境設定方法はapache2を使用します...
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

Video Face Swap

Video Face Swap

完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

ホットツール

メモ帳++7.3.1

メモ帳++7.3.1

使いやすく無料のコードエディター

SublimeText3 中国語版

SublimeText3 中国語版

中国語版、とても使いやすい

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強力な PHP 統合開発環境

ドリームウィーバー CS6

ドリームウィーバー CS6

ビジュアル Web 開発ツール

SublimeText3 Mac版

SublimeText3 Mac版

神レベルのコード編集ソフト(SublimeText3)

PHP:Web開発の重要な言語 PHP:Web開発の重要な言語 Apr 13, 2025 am 12:08 AM

PHPは、サーバー側で広く使用されているスクリプト言語で、特にWeb開発に適しています。 1.PHPは、HTMLを埋め込み、HTTP要求と応答を処理し、さまざまなデータベースをサポートできます。 2.PHPは、ダイナミックWebコンテンツ、プロセスフォームデータ、アクセスデータベースなどを生成するために使用され、強力なコミュニティサポートとオープンソースリソースを備えています。 3。PHPは解釈された言語であり、実行プロセスには語彙分析、文法分析、編集、実行が含まれます。 4.PHPは、ユーザー登録システムなどの高度なアプリケーションについてMySQLと組み合わせることができます。 5。PHPをデバッグするときは、error_reporting()やvar_dump()などの関数を使用できます。 6. PHPコードを最適化して、キャッシュメカニズムを使用し、データベースクエリを最適化し、組み込み関数を使用します。 7

PHPとPython:2つの一般的なプログラミング言語を比較します PHPとPython:2つの一般的なプログラミング言語を比較します Apr 14, 2025 am 12:13 AM

PHPとPythonにはそれぞれ独自の利点があり、プロジェクトの要件に従って選択します。 1.PHPは、特にWebサイトの迅速な開発とメンテナンスに適しています。 2。Pythonは、データサイエンス、機械学習、人工知能に適しており、簡潔な構文を備えており、初心者に適しています。

PHP対Python:違いを理解します PHP対Python:違いを理解します Apr 11, 2025 am 12:15 AM

PHP and Python each have their own advantages, and the choice should be based on project requirements. 1.PHPは、シンプルな構文と高い実行効率を備えたWeb開発に適しています。 2。Pythonは、簡潔な構文とリッチライブラリを備えたデータサイエンスと機械学習に適しています。

アクション中のPHP:実際の例とアプリケーション アクション中のPHP:実際の例とアプリケーション Apr 14, 2025 am 12:19 AM

PHPは、電子商取引、コンテンツ管理システム、API開発で広く使用されています。 1)eコマース:ショッピングカート機能と支払い処理に使用。 2)コンテンツ管理システム:動的コンテンツの生成とユーザー管理に使用されます。 3)API開発:RESTFUL API開発とAPIセキュリティに使用されます。パフォーマンスの最適化とベストプラクティスを通じて、PHPアプリケーションの効率と保守性が向上します。

PHPの永続的な関連性:それはまだ生きていますか? PHPの永続的な関連性:それはまだ生きていますか? Apr 14, 2025 am 12:12 AM

PHPは依然として動的であり、現代のプログラミングの分野で重要な位置を占めています。 1)PHPのシンプルさと強力なコミュニティサポートにより、Web開発で広く使用されています。 2)その柔軟性と安定性により、Webフォーム、データベース操作、ファイル処理の処理において顕著になります。 3)PHPは、初心者や経験豊富な開発者に適した、常に進化し、最適化しています。

PHP対その他の言語:比較 PHP対その他の言語:比較 Apr 13, 2025 am 12:19 AM

PHPは、特に迅速な開発や動的なコンテンツの処理に適していますが、データサイエンスとエンタープライズレベルのアプリケーションには良くありません。 Pythonと比較して、PHPはWeb開発においてより多くの利点がありますが、データサイエンスの分野ではPythonほど良くありません。 Javaと比較して、PHPはエンタープライズレベルのアプリケーションでより悪化しますが、Web開発により柔軟性があります。 JavaScriptと比較して、PHPはバックエンド開発により簡潔ですが、フロントエンド開発のJavaScriptほど良くありません。

PHPおよびPython:さまざまなパラダイムが説明されています PHPおよびPython:さまざまなパラダイムが説明されています Apr 18, 2025 am 12:26 AM

PHPは主に手順プログラミングですが、オブジェクト指向プログラミング(OOP)もサポートしています。 Pythonは、OOP、機能、手続き上のプログラミングなど、さまざまなパラダイムをサポートしています。 PHPはWeb開発に適しており、Pythonはデータ分析や機械学習などのさまざまなアプリケーションに適しています。

PHPおよびPython:コードの例と比較 PHPおよびPython:コードの例と比較 Apr 15, 2025 am 12:07 AM

PHPとPythonには独自の利点と短所があり、選択はプロジェクトのニーズと個人的な好みに依存します。 1.PHPは、大規模なWebアプリケーションの迅速な開発とメンテナンスに適しています。 2。Pythonは、データサイエンスと機械学習の分野を支配しています。

See all articles